Types of Preschool Maths Activities Printable



There are several types of printable math activities suitable for preschoolers. Here are some popular categories:

1. Counting Activities



Counting is one of the fundamental skills in early math education. Printable counting activities can help children understand numbers and develop their counting skills.


  • Counting Cards: Printable cards with images or objects that children can count and match to the corresponding number.

  • Dot-to-Dot Worksheets: These worksheets require children to connect the dots in numerical order, helping them practice counting and number recognition.

  • Counting Worksheets: Simple worksheets where children can practice writing numbers and counting objects in groups.



2. Shape Recognition Activities



Understanding shapes is critical for early math development. Printable shape recognition activities can make learning about shapes exciting.


  • Shape Matching Games: Print and cut out different shapes for children to match with images or other shapes.

  • Shape Coloring Sheets: Printable sheets that encourage children to color different shapes while learning their names and properties.

  • Shape Scavenger Hunts: Create a printable checklist of shapes for children to find around the house or classroom.



3. Measurement Activities



Introducing basic measurement concepts can be fun with engaging printables.


  • Comparative Measurement Worksheets: Worksheets that ask children to compare lengths, heights, or weights of different objects.

  • Measurement Cut-Outs: Printable rulers or measuring tapes that children can use to measure items around them.

  • Size Sorting Activities: Printables that encourage children to sort objects by size, supporting their understanding of measurement concepts.



4. Addition and Subtraction Activities



Basic addition and subtraction are essential early math skills. Here are some printable resources to help with these concepts.


  • Number Bonds Worksheets: Visual aids that help children understand the relationship between addition and subtraction.

  • Story Problems: Simple printable story problems that children can use to practice addition and subtraction in real-world scenarios.

  • Counting Bears Activities: Using printable bear counters to create hands-on addition and subtraction problems.



5. Math Games and Puzzles



Games and puzzles can make learning math concepts more dynamic and enjoyable.


  • Math Bingo: Print bingo cards with numbers or math problems for a fun, interactive game.

  • Printable Board Games: Create board games that incorporate counting, addition, or subtraction for an enjoyable learning experience.

  • Math Puzzles: Printable jigsaw puzzles that require children to solve math problems to complete the puzzle.



How to Use Printable Math Activities Effectively



To ensure that your preschool maths activities printable are used effectively, consider the following tips:

1. Integrate Activities into Daily Routines



Incorporate math activities into everyday routines to reinforce learning. For example, count items during grocery shopping, measure ingredients while cooking, or sort toys by size or shape.

2. Create a Math Center



Set up a dedicated math center in your classroom or home where children can access a variety of math printables. Rotate activities regularly to keep them fresh and engaging.

3. Encourage Group Learning



Use printable activities as a way to promote collaborative learning. Group activities can help children learn from one another, share ideas, and develop social skills alongside their math skills.

4. Provide Positive Reinforcement



Celebrate achievements, no matter how small. Praise children for their efforts and encourage them to keep trying, creating a positive environment for learning.

5. Assess Progress



Keep track of children's progress through their completed printables. Assessing their understanding of concepts can help you tailor future activities to meet their needs better.
